  • Does Application Management Pack (for E-Business) need a separate license?

    Hi, I am licensed for Oracle Enterprise Manager 11g Release 1 Grid Control 11.1.0.1.0.
    Now I want to add Application Management Pack for E-Business R11i and R12. Do I need to purchase a new license?
    From my existing installation there is a link About OEM -> ... License Information; I don't see any entry for E-Business Suite management.
    Thanks,

    Yes, you need to license Application Management Suite for E-Business Suite to cover the EBS management functionality. In both EM 11g and EM 12c, you need to download the plug-in for EBS. In the case of EM 12c, you can simply use the self-update feature to quickly get the EBS plug-in. For 11g, you will have to get it via e-Delivery.

  • Oracle Application Management Pack for Siebel 10gR4 is GA

    Oracle Application Management Pack for Siebel 10gR4 is now generally available.
    Go to this OTN page if you want more information about the product.
    http://www.oracle.com/technology/products/oem/prod_focus/app_mgmt.html
    You may also download it from OTN to try it out as part of Enterprise Manager 10gR4. We will be demonstrating it at booths D8 and J7 at the Oracle Demoground at Moscone South Hall, at session S291922 at Moscone West L2-2001 on Monday, 11/12 from 3:15 to 4:15 p.m., and at the Siebel Pack Hands-on Lab (S294089) at Marriott Hotel Golden Gate Room B1 on Thursday, 11/15 from 11:30 a.m.-12:30 p.m.
    The Siebel Pack is designed to be a complete and integrated management tool for Siebel. Using this management pack, you may get proactive alerts on impending problems on the application, examine run-time statistics to troubleshoot and tune performance, compare configurations across different environments, keep track of configuration changes, proactively enforce configuration policies in order to avoid configuration related problems, monitor and report on service level delivered by the application and performance diagnostics of user and server performance. The pack may be used with other Oracle Enterprise Manager management packs and plug-in’s to achieve end-to-end management of the entire application environment, including both Oracle and non-Oracle databases, operating systems, storage and network devices.
    The 10gR4 release of this pack adds integrated Siebel Transaction Diagnostic support using data captured via Siebel Application Response Measurement (SARM) framework. With this tool, you may:
    - Analyze request processing for individual user requests
    - Analyze CPU and memory consumption of processing requests for different Siebel Server Components
    - Visualize SARM metric data graphically
    - Compare performance profiles over time
    - Create performance reports and share them with your co-worker for collaborative performance diagnostics
    The 10gR4 version of this Siebel Transaction Diagnostic tool also adds support for Siebel 7.7 and 7.8 in addition to being compatible with Siebel 8.0. It is fully integrated with Oracle Enterprise Manager, which eliminates the need for separate install and user maintenance, and it runs on all operating system platforms that Oracle Enterprise Manager supports.
